About this spot
Au Derby delivers classic Belgian comfort food with a focus on hearty stews and golden frites that are essential for any traveler's stomach. The kitchen specializes in traditional preparations where the meat is slow-cooked until it falls apart, making it perfect for those seeking an authentic local dining experience. Expect generous portions of mussels or lamb dishes that showcase the region's rich culinary heritage without unnecessary frills.

Common Questions
How much does Au Derby cost?
Prices range from €15 to €30 per person, roughly $16 to $32 USD depending on the main course chosen.
Where is Au Derby?
Located in the Sainte-Catherine neighborhood of Brussels, near the central train station at Rue de la Régence 42.
What should I order first?
Start with a bowl of waterzooi, a creamy chicken or fish stew, followed by their signature crispy frites and a local lamb dish.
